    <title>Delhi CM presents Rs 1 lakh cr &#039;historic budget&#039;; health, water, connectivity key focus areas</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/news?id=38464</link>
    <description>The fiscal statement increases capital expenditure and reprioritises resource allocation toward urban infrastructure, waterway rejuvenation via decentralised and upgraded sewage treatment facilities, and extensive potable water and sanitation projects. It earmarks programmatic funds for health centre expansion and a health initiative, transport link improvements, women&#039;s welfare benefits and safety measures, slum cluster development, and education reforms including CM SHRI Schools and targeted student support. Complementary economic measures include a new industrial and warehouse policy, a Traders&#039; Welfare Board, biennial investment summits, and skills support for small industries.</description>
